A balloon end contact scope device for performing laser-assisted transmyocardial revascularization (TMR) or other surgical and catheter procedures, the device particularly adapted for delivery of laser energy via a laser delivery means and configured to reach inside a body cavity or organ chamber at a point not directly accessible, either visually or otherwise, such as in a lateral or posterior position, the device having a hollow outer lumen, balloon scope portion with an internal guide tube extending through the balloon portion for directing a laser delivery means or other surgical or catheter device through the visualization balloon toward the area being visualized. The balloon scope portion may have a plurality of guide holes extending therethrough. On the essentially transparent contact viewing surface a high friction surface may be applied to facilitate precise positioning and treatment therethrough. The device can be used for attaching a guide tether for placing marking devices or fluoroscopic locators, or for placing other interventional devices. A method of visualizing and treating the heart, other organs and internal parts of the human body comprising the following steps: prividing a balloon end contact scope with a main lumen and an essentially transparent contact viewing portion of a predetermined size and material of construction and integral laser delivery means or other equipment channel suitable for viewing the heart other organs and internal parts of the human body; precisely positioning the contact viewing portion in contact with a portion of the heart, other organ or internal body part adjacent the position to be viewed; and visualizing the heart, other organ or internal body part. The method can be used to place a guide wire or tether to the heart, other organ or internal body part in order to locate a nuoroscopic or other visualization means or to perform additional visualization, fluoroscopic marking or other interventional procedure. The method also comprises the step of delivering laser energy to a portion of the heart to effect transmyocardial revascularization. The method can be performed either by surgically introducing a balloon end viewing scope into the chest cavity of a patient and through the pericardial sac of the heart to a position between the pericardial sac and the epicardial surface of the heart or by introducing a balloon end viewing scope into the vasculature of a patient, for example at a point on the femoral artery, and into an internal chamber of the heart.
